- 購買阿里雲RDS
- 設置公網訪問鏈接地址
- 賬號管理,新增賬號設置權限
- 設置白名單,
curl ipinfo.io |grep ip
獲取 ip
,或訪問 https://www.whatismyip.com 或 https://www.whatismyip.net,比如 100.104.175.0/24
- 通過 redis-cli 連接
$ redis-cli -h 公網訪問鏈接地址.redis.rds.aliyuncs.com
公網訪問鏈接地址.redis.rds.aliyuncs.com:6379> AUTH 自定義用戶名: 密碼
OK
- 通過 go-redis 連接
package main
import (
"fmt"
"github.com/go-redis/redis"
"log"
)
var rdb *redis.Client
func main() {
rdb = redis.NewClient(&redis.Options{
Addr: "公網訪問鏈接地址.redis.rds.aliyuncs.com:6379",
Password: "自定義用戶名:密碼",
DB: 0,
})
_, err := rdb.Ping().Result()
if err != nil {
log.Fatal(err)
}
fmt.Println("連接成功")
}